Go to file
Nalla Pradeep 6195062454 net/octeontx_ep: set up IQ and OQ registers
Configuring hardware registers with command queue (IQ) and driver output
queue (OQ) parameters.
List of parameters configured for IQ after making sure it is idle
1. Base address
2. Instruction size
3. Disabling interrupts for fastpath

List of parameters configured for OQ after making sure it is idle
1. Base address
2. Output buffer size
3. Clear output queue doorbell
4. Disable interrupts for fastpath

Signed-off-by: Nalla Pradeep <pnalla@marvell.com>
Reviewed-by: Ferruh Yigit <ferruh.yigit@intel.com>
2021-01-29 18:16:12 +01:00
.ci ci: enable header includes check 2021-01-29 20:59:37 +01:00
.github/workflows buildtools: use Python pmdinfogen 2021-01-25 23:23:41 +01:00
app app/testpmd: avoid exit without terminal restore 2021-01-29 18:16:12 +01:00
buildtools build: add header includes check 2021-01-29 20:59:37 +01:00
config config: disable AVX512 with MinGW 2021-01-28 22:15:10 +01:00
devtools bus/vdev: add driver IOVA VA mode requirement 2021-01-29 18:16:09 +01:00
doc net/octeontx_ep: add device info get and configure 2021-01-29 18:16:12 +01:00
drivers net/octeontx_ep: set up IQ and OQ registers 2021-01-29 18:16:12 +01:00
examples examples/vhost: refactor vhost data path 2021-01-29 18:16:09 +01:00
kernel kni: fix build on RHEL 8.3 2020-11-27 01:39:54 +01:00
lib ethdev: add MPLS RSS offload type 2021-01-29 18:16:08 +01:00
license license: add licenses for exception cases 2020-12-11 12:22:19 +01:00
usertools usertools: remove dpdk-setup.sh 2020-11-27 17:25:24 +01:00
.editorconfig devtools: add EditorConfig file 2020-02-22 21:05:22 +01:00
.gitattributes improve git diff 2016-11-13 15:25:12 +01:00
.gitignore regex/mlx5: introduce driver for BlueField 2 2020-07-21 19:04:05 +02:00
.travis.yml ci: add aarch64 clang cross-compilation Travis builds 2021-01-26 12:43:04 +01:00
ABI_VERSION version: 21.02-rc0 2020-11-30 10:55:22 +01:00
MAINTAINERS net/octeontx_ep: add build and doc infrastructure 2021-01-29 18:16:12 +01:00
Makefile build: create dummy Makefile 2020-09-07 23:51:57 +02:00
meson_options.txt build: add header includes check 2021-01-29 20:59:37 +01:00
meson.build build: add header includes check 2021-01-29 20:59:37 +01:00
README license: introduce SPDX identifiers 2018-01-04 22:41:38 +01:00
VERSION version: 21.02-rc1 2021-01-20 02:58:16 +01:00

DPDK is a set of libraries and drivers for fast packet processing.
It supports many processor architectures and both FreeBSD and Linux.

The DPDK uses the Open Source BSD-3-Clause license for the core libraries
and drivers. The kernel components are GPL-2.0 licensed.

Please check the doc directory for release notes,
API documentation, and sample application information.

For questions and usage discussions, subscribe to: users@dpdk.org
Report bugs and issues to the development mailing list: dev@dpdk.org